Wienerbrød (Danish Pastry)

Yeasted dough laminated with butter, rolled around a cardamom-and-butter remonce and baked until the layers separate — called Vienna bread in Denmark, because Austrian bakers brought it.

Приготовление

  1. Mix the flour, milk, egg, yeast, sugar, salt and cardamom into a dough. Knead 5 minutes, wrap and chill 1 hour.

  2. Beat the cold butter between two sheets of paper into a 20 cm square. Keep it cold and pliable, not soft.

    💡 Butter and dough must be the same firmness. Butter harder than the dough shatters into shards; softer, and it smears through and there are no layers.

  3. Roll the dough to 40 cm square, set the butter in the middle at 45 degrees and fold the corners over to seal it in.

  4. Roll out to a long rectangle and fold in three. Chill 30 minutes. Repeat this twice more — three folds in total.

  5. Beat the remonce butter and sugar together. Roll the dough to 40 × 30 cm, spread the remonce over it and roll it up from the long side.

  6. Cut into 12 slices, lay them cut side up, prove 45 minutes, brush with egg, scatter with pearl sugar and bake at 200°C for 15 minutes.

💡 Советы

  • The Danish name means Vienna bread. Austrian bakers brought the method during an 1850 bakers' strike, and Denmark kept it and made it better.
  • Work in a cold kitchen if you can, and put the dough back in the fridge the moment the butter starts to shine through.
  • Three folds, not six. Danish pastry has fewer layers than croissant dough and is meant to be softer and breadier.
